Is faith the opposite of doubt?

Doubts are a natural part of believing. Doubts do not equate with unbelief. Christian theologian Paul Tillich wrote, “Doubt isn’t the opposite of faith; it is an element of faith.” In Genesis Abraham doubted whether God was really going to make good on his promise to give him and Sarah a son.

What is the sentence of doubt?

Examples of doubt in a Sentence

I seriously doubt my parents will let me go. “Do you think you can come tonight?” “I doubt it.” She doubted his ability to succeed. He said he could do it, but I couldn’t help doubting him.

What does doubt mean in text?

to be uncertain about; consider questionable or unlikely; hesitate to believe: The police have good reason to doubt his alibi. to distrust; regard with suspicion: I doubted the salesman, so we decided to check with other dealers. Archaic. to fear; be apprehensive about. SEE MORE.

Whats stronger fear or love?

Niccolò Machiavelli was a political theorist from the Renaissance period. In his most notable work, The Prince, he writes, “It is better to be feared than to be loved, if one cannot be both.” He argues that fear is a better motivator than love, which is why it is the more effective tool for leaders.

What is opposite action in anxiety?

Opposite Actions of Anxiety:

Do what you are afraid to do – Over and Over again! Acting in Opposite sometimes means simply APPROACHING the things that you’re afraid of. Take part in things that give you a sense of autonomy, agency and mastery over your fears and anxiety.

What emotion is behind anger?

Emotions that can Trigger

Because anger is easier to feel, it can distract you from experiencing and healing the pain you feel inside. Among the most triggering primary emotions is frustration. Frustration is often experienced when you are feeling helpless or out of control.
